The Original Cafe Du Monde in the French Quarter

If you are looking for a true taste of Cafe Du Monde history, then the original location in the French Quarter should be your top choice. Situated in close proximity to popular attractions like Bourbon Street, Jackson Square, and the iconic St. Louis Cathedral, this Cafe Du Monde is an integral part of the city’s vibrant culture.

Walking into the original Cafe Du Monde is like stepping back in time. The aromas of freshly brewed coffee and warm beignets fill the air, enticing your senses from the moment you enter. The bustling atmosphere, with both locals and tourists alike, creates a lively and authentic New Orleans experience.

Why Choose the French Quarter Location?

The French Quarter location offers more than just its historical significance. By visiting this Cafe Du Monde, you’ll have the opportunity to explore the heart of the city. After indulging in the iconic beignets and café au lait at Cafe Du Monde, you can easily wander the streets, taking in the rich history and unique architecture that surrounds you.

With its close proximity to other popular attractions, you can plan a full day of exploration without having to venture too far. From picturesque Jackson Square, where street performers entertain passersby, to the lively energy of Bourbon Street, the French Quarter location provides easy access to the best of New Orleans.

Other Cafe Du Monde Locations

While the original Cafe Du Monde holds a special place in the hearts of many, it’s worth mentioning that there are other locations throughout the city. These alternate cafes provide convenient options for those who may be staying outside of the French Quarter or want to experience Cafe Du Monde in a slightly less crowded atmosphere.

Whether you choose the location in the Central Business District or the one in the New Orleans Riverwalk Outlet Collection, you can still savor the famous beignets and coffee that have made Cafe Du Monde a beloved institution. While these locations may not offer the same historical charm as the French Quarter, they allow for a more relaxed and peaceful setting.
